1.1 Asset Allocation: The Foundation of Diversification
A diversified portfolio typically involves allocating investments across different asset classes, such as stocks, bonds, real estate, and alternative investments like private equity or commodities. The specific allocation depends on risk tolerance and financial goals. Choi’s success suggests a well-crafted asset allocation strategy suited to his risk profile and long-term objectives.
1.2 Geographic Diversification: Expanding Horizons
Geographic diversification involves spreading investments across different countries and regions. This reduces the impact of economic or political instability in a single region. For high-net-worth individuals like Choi, international diversification is almost certainly a key part of their strategy.

4. Cultivating a Long-Term Perspective
Building lasting wealth requires a long-term vision and the discipline to stick to a well-defined plan. Short-term market fluctuations should not derail a well-crafted strategy.
4.1 Patience and Discipline: Resisting Emotional Decision-Making
Emotional investing, driven by fear or greed, can lead to poor decisions. Sticking to a well-defined investment strategy, even during market downturns, is paramount for long-term success. This aspect is often overlooked but crucial for achieving lasting wealth.
4.2 Regular Portfolio Review and Adjustments: Adapting to Market Changes
While maintaining a long-term outlook, regular portfolio reviews are essential. Market conditions change, and adjustments might be necessary to align the portfolio with evolving goals and risk tolerance.
5. Strategic Tax Planning and Wealth Preservation
Minimizing tax liabilities and effectively preserving wealth are critical for maximizing long-term financial gains.
5.1 Tax-Efficient Investing: Optimizing Returns
Understanding tax implications of different investment vehicles and employing tax-advantaged strategies is crucial for wealth preservation. This often requires professional financial and legal advice.
5.2 Estate Planning: Securing the Legacy
Proper estate planning ensures that wealth is transferred efficiently and according to the individual’s wishes, minimizing potential tax burdens and legal complications.
